Why Choose Lesser-Known Destinations?

Traveling to lesser-known destinations can provide a more immersive experience. According to industry experts, such locations often allow travelers to connect with local cultures on a deeper level. This approach not only enhances personal experiences but also contributes to sustainable tourism practices.

How to Plan Your Trip

When considering a visit to a lesser-known European destination, here are some practical steps to follow:

  1. Research Your Options: Look for destinations that are less frequented but offer rich cultural experiences. Websites and travel blogs can provide valuable insights.
  2. Contact a Slow Travel Agency: Collaborating with an agency can help you create a tailored itinerary that emphasizes your interests while ensuring a low-stimulation travel experience.
  3. Allocate Sufficient Time: Allow for 2-4 weeks to fully immerse yourself in your chosen destination. This ensures you can explore various aspects of local life without feeling rushed.
